Principal Machine Learning Engineer, Applied Generative AI (CSxAI)
As a Principal Machine Learning Engineer, you will lead the development and optimization of state-of-the-art Large Language Models (LLMs) for Airbnb's Customer Support AI initiatives. This role involves partnering with cross-functional teams to design and implement impactful AI products for diverse applications within the travel domain. You will be responsible for defining the technical roadmap and driving key architectural decisions for AI products on Airbnb's ML platform.
Machine Learning and Artificial Intelligence are at the heart of the Airbnb product. From Trust to Payments, and from Customer Service to Marketing, we rely on ML to ensure that guests and hosts have the best possible experience with Airbnb.
The CS AI product team is responsible for driving CSxAI (Customer Support x Artificial Intelligence) initiatives by adopting Generative AI technologies to enable an intelligent, scalable, and exceptional service experience. The team develops and enhances various AI models, ML services, and tools including LLM fine-tuning, alignment and optimization, RAG/Search, LLM evaluation and testing automation, feedback-based learning, and guardrail for a wide range of applications in Airbnb.
As a principal machine learning engineer, you will be responsible for fine-tuning state-of-the-art LLMs for diverse use cases while optimizing models for high-performance deployment on Airbnb’s ML Infrastructure. You will partner with product managers, software engineers, data scientists, and operation teams to brainstorm, design, and develop AI products such as AI Assistant, Autonomous agent, recommendation, travel planning, and many more products that make meaningful impacts in the world of travel.
Posted June 3, 2026